LEGAL ASPECT OF DOCTORS' RESPONSIBILITY IN PRESCRIPTION

Endang Sutrisno, Ely Hikmawati

Sari


Indonesia is a country of laws so that to run a country and protect human rights must be based on law where the basic rules are regulated in the 1945 Constitution. This becomes a guideline for making regulations under it.Formulated in Article 4 of Law 36/2009 which states that "Everyone has the right to health". This concept of the right to health refers to the meaning of the right to obtain health services from health facilities in order to realize the highest degree of health..The profession of a doctor is related to the safety and health of other people, the main basis for doctors to be able to perform medical actions on other people is knowledge, technology and competence. lead to errors in therapy to the detriment of other people and institutions.
